Lufthansa Cargo launches ‘myAirCargo’ service

Lufthansa Cargo has launched ‘myAirCargo’, giving private customers the chance to move bulky items internationally by air.

The logistics subsidiary of Lufthansa says it will organise the transportation from door-to-door, taking care of customs formalities along the way, and will be useful for goods such as sizeable souvenirs from exotic holidays. The service is only available online and can be booked in five steps, with the price of the shipment and expected customs fees displayed directly and can be settled by credit card.

Lufthansa Cargo chief executive officer, Peter Gerber says: “We are excited that private clients can now benefit directly from our many years of air cargo experience. By doing so, we are occupying an innovative niche in the market between postal services and forwarders. Book air cargo quickly and easily online, at first hand – only we can do that.”

The service is available between most European countries and the USA and will be introduced across Lufthansa’s network in the coming months.
